Chapter 277

Stella stopped in her tracks, staring at him in disbelief.

"What did you just say?"

Haynes gave her a crooked smile. "You suddenly changed your mind, refused to give me Rachel's medication, then turned around and demanded money from me -and on top of that, you deliberately made things difficult for Rachel over something trivial..."

He arched an eyebrow. "Stella, are you sure you're not just doing all this to get my attention?"

Stella couldn't help but laugh. "Haynes, your ego honestly knows no bounds. Not everyone is desperate enough to pick up what someone else has thrown away. If she doesn't find it disgusting, I certainly do."

Her words wiped the smile from both Haynes and Rachel's faces.

Stella recalled the hefty bank transfer she'd just received, and without another word, tossed the life-saving medication to Haynes.

"I keep my promises. That's the full first round of treatment. If she doesn't take it and things get worse, don't come blaming me."

With that, Stella shook off Haynes's grip on her wrist and turned to go.

But Haynes blocked her way again. "You haven't apologized to Rachel yet."
